#492d44 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#492d44 is composed of 28.6% red, 17.6% green and 26.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 38.4% magenta, 6.8% yellow and 71.4% black. It has a hue angle of 310.7 degrees, a saturation of 23.7% and a lightness of 23.1%. #492d44 color hex could be obtained by blending #925a88 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

● #492d44 color description : Very dark desaturated magenta.
#492d44 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#492d44 has RGB values of R:73, G:45, B:68 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.38, Y:0.07, K:0.71. Its decimal value is 4795716.
